Has anyone use the bolt mounted McLaughlin Metalworks sight? Debating contacting them for sights for my pre-64 375 Model 70 that currently does not have sights and a new production Model 70 that’s being converted to 400 H&H. It looks like I would want to open up the aperture to make it more of a quick backup sight but didn’t know how good it would be mounted to the rear of the bolt. It shows that this was a site type used on some of the Rigby’s but wanted to know any thoughts as a good site for a dangerous game rifle.

Any info would be appreciated.
